I travel alot and am always concerned leaving my car in hotel parking lots. Someone suggested that I get a wireless baby monitor and leave the transmitter in my car and keep the receiver in my room, that way I can hear if anything was going on in my car. This might be a good idea for some of you that have to park your cars outside. Just a suggestion.
